For a solo campaign, I'd go with one of the following 3 ideas:
1. Druid. As other have said, it's as close to a one man party as it gets. You can melee, are a full caster, you have an animal companion and SNA creatures make for dispsable trapfinders.
2. DMM: Persist (cloistered) cleric with kobold and travel domain. You are a full caster by default (although cleric spell list lacks in certain areas), DMM: Persist makes you a combat powerhouse at lvl 7+, and Kobold (trapfinding) and Travel (mobility) help round your character in two very important areas.
3. Chameleon. You can build this char in quite a number of ways (my favorite is cloistered cleric 1/paladin 2/fighter2/chameleon x; I think credit must go to Caelic for that), but you will most certainly be able to cope with a lot of situations due to the inherent customization of your abilities the class allows you to do daily
